Is there any sort of music scene in Peterborough? by scallop_slayer in Peterborough

[–]Live_Replacement_977 20 points21 points  (0 children)

The local music scene is very much alive! If you have social media follow Jethro's, Pig's Ear, Market Hall, Gordon Best etc. Come to the Peterborough Folk Festival Aug. 16-17 at Nicholls Oval- there will be lots of local musicians playing. When you go to a show in town to see (Melissa Payne, Nicholas Campbell, Silverhearts to name a tiny few) you will see many local musicians coming out to support them and a lot of love all around. Our city is a hotbed of great musicians.

Peterborough Folk Festival is just around the corner! August 16-17 at Nicholls Oval. No entrance fee We are always looking for more volunteers. Especially parking volunteers. Volunteers get fed and get a beautiful t-shirt. Check out peterboroughfolkfest.com and hit the volunteer signup button.  Or just come to the festival. We've got 3 stages, a licensed beer pavilion, 11 food vendors, Children's Village!!, artisan village, valet bike parking etc.... All of our performers are Canadian and include BIPOC and trans performers. 50% of our performers identify as female, and we will have lots of local musicians performing, including Jeanne Truax our 2025 Emerging Artist winner.
